Internal Family Systems (IFS) Therapy

  • IFS therapy is a transformative approach that views the mind as comprised of various "parts," each with its own unique perspective and role. These parts, like members of an internal family, can sometimes be detrimental to your wellbeing or be in conflict with one another, leading to emotional distress and challenging behaviors. IFS helps you understand and connect with these parts, fostering self-compassion and healing. By learning to listen to and attend to your inner system, you can achieve greater harmony, resolve internal conflicts, and cultivate a stronger, more authentic sense of self.

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R)

  • EMDR therapy is a powerful technique used to treat trauma and other distressing life experiences. It helps you process and integrate difficult memories, reducing their emotional charge and allowing you to heal from past wounds. Your safety and comfort are the top priority, and the pace of the reprocessing is always guided by you. The technique helps your brain reprocess the traumatic event, leading to a decrease in symptoms like anxiety, flashbacks, and negative beliefs. EMDR can help you feel more grounded, empowered, and able to move forward in your life.

When combined:

  • IFS and EMDR can create a powerful combination in psychotherapy that goes beyond the limits of traditional talk therapy.

Here's why:

  • IFS provides a framework for understanding the internal world, helping clients identify and connect with different parts of themselves. This fosters self-compassion and inner harmony.

  • EMDR effectively processes trauma and distressing memories that some parts hold, allowing clients to release emotional blocks and reduce the intensity of painful experiences. It targets the neurological roots of trauma.
